Transcript Updates
Norris High School final transcripts were mailed off by Thursday June 1st to the college you listed on the senior survey. According to UNL, we can expect those to be processed by the end of this month (they are currently backlogged with over 3,000 transcripts). Any requested transcripts for dual credit classes from SCC were mailed to the respective college issuing dual credit on May 26th. Please allow time for those colleges to process the transcript request and send it off to your attending college. If you did not have a chance to fill out a dual credit transcript request, you may still do that on your own (submit online for Wesleyan and Peru). If you need a Norris high school transcript in the future, you will use the link transcript request form found on the guidance webpage.
NCAA/NAIA
Final Norris transcripts were mailed off by Thursday June 1st for all registered NCAA or NAIA students. Be sure YOU SENT YOUR ACT scores directly to the NCAA clearinghouse or NAIA eligibility center~ you will do this directly from your ACT student account online. This is not something we can do for you.
Scholarship Updates~ send a Thank you!
Informative letters were mailed out to scholarship recipients from the honors convocation. Exact names of scholarships received, as well as contact addresses were included. Show your appreciation to those who have donated to your educational journey with a hand written thank you note. Including your post secondary plans would be of interest to them.
